How has COVID-19 changed the landscape of teacher training? 🔊
COVID-19 has dramatically altered the landscape of teacher training, necessitating a rapid adaptation to online and hybrid teaching models. Educators had to quickly acquire digital skills and navigate new technological tools to facilitate learning. This shift has highlighted the importance of flexibility and ongoing professional development in teaching. Training programs have increasingly focused on remote instruction, engaging students virtually, and addressing issues such as student wellness during pandemic-related challenges. Furthermore, the crisis has underscored the need for equity in access to resources, prompting discussions about the future of teaching practices and policies in a post-pandemic world.
